Jazz Waltz feel with sections in straight 4 swing feel. From Wikipedia: ""Click Go the Shears" is a traditional Australian bush ballad. The song details a day's work for a sheep shearer in the days before machine shears. In June 2013 it was discovered that a version of the song was first published in 1891 in the regional Victorian newspaper the Bacchus Marsh Express under the title "The Bare Belled Ewe" and the tune given as "Ring the Bell Watchman." That version was signed "C. C. Eynesbury, Nov. 20, 1891,"Eynesbury being a rural property located in the Bacchus Marsh area. It is possible that "C.C." was the author of the song." .
